Roles and Responsibilities

These responsibilities ensure robust identity and access management, enhancing security and compliance within the organization.

  • Solution Development and Customization: Develops and customizes SailPoint Identity Now (ICS) solutions to meet the specific needs of the organization. Creates custom workflows, rules, and connectors to integrate with various systems and applications.
  • Implementation and Configuration: Configures SailPoint ICS components, including identity governance, role management, and access certifications. Ensures that the solution aligns with business requirements and security policies.
  • Application Integration: Integrates SailPoint with other enterprise applications such as HR systems, Active Directory, and cloud services. Develops and maintains connectors and APIs to support seamless data exchange.
  • Testing and Quality Assurance: Conducts thorough testing of SailPoint solutions to ensure functionality, performance, and security. Identifies and resolves defects and ensures that the implemented solutions meet quality standards.
  • Documentation and Training: Creates comprehensive documentation for developed solutions, including technical specifications, configuration guides, and user manuals. Provides training and support to IT staff and end-users to ensure effective use of SailPoint.
  • These responsibilities ensure that SailPoint is effectively implemented, customized, and maintained to support the organization's identity and access management needs. Design and Implement IAM solution and tools to manage R1’s expanding cloud identities and SaaS application footprints.
  • Work with application owners to integrate application security and application roles with centralized IAM IDPs.
  • Work with Offshore teams, stakeholders, Vendors for IAM governance tasks and activities.

Skills and Experience:

  • 5 years of experience with SailPoint Identity Now (ICS).
  • 5 years of IAM related programing experience.
  • 3 years of experience building SailPoint connectors. Not OOTB connectors.
  • Understanding of modern authentication solutions using SAML/OAuth/OIDC
  • Knowledgeable with Microsoft Azure and Amazon Web Services (AWS).
  • Familiarity with Workday and ServiceNow
  • This role will be required to work in flexible shift timings supporting US business hours.

Education:

  • Bachelors degree in technology or related fields preferred.
